Pickering乳液模板法制备多孔分子印迹聚合物的进展 被引量:4

Development of Porous Imprinted Polymers Synthesized via Pickering Emulsion Template

摘要 对近年来Pickering乳液模板法制备多孔分子印迹聚合物的工作进行了总结,阐述了Pickering单乳液、Pickering双乳液以及Pickering高内相乳液法分别制备中空、多孔微球以及泡沫的结构分子印迹聚合物的过程、界面行为调控和对应构效关系;指出了3类方法的优势、适用范围与存在的不足之处,并对微纳米稳定粒子选择、乳液形成方式、应用领域拓展等方面的研究设想进行了展望. This work reviews the studies about porous imprinted polymers via Pickering emulsion template. The hollow imprinted polymers,porous imprinted polymers and imprinted polymer foams can be prepared by Pickering single emulsion,Pickering double emulsion and Pickering high internal phase emulsion,respectively,and their interface behaviors and structure-activity relationship were described. Meanwhile,the merits,disadvantages and application fields of three emulsion template were commented. Finally,the expectation of this research containing the selection of micro / nano particles,formation ways of stable emulsion was illustrated.
